我有个滚动图片代码 在独立的页面可以滚动 调用到首页后 就又停下来了 不动了 为什么
<divid=demostyle="overflow:hidden;width:128px;height:300px;"><divid=demo1><ul><li>图片连...
<div id=demo style="overflow:hidden; width:128px; height:300px;">
<div id=demo1>
<ul>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
</ul>
</div>
<div id=demo2></div>
</div>
<script language="javascript">
var speed=10
demo2.innerHTML=demo1.innerHTML
function Marquee(){
if(demo2.offsetTop-demo.scrollTop<=0)
demo.scrollTop-=demo1.offsetHeight
else{
demo.scrollTop++
}
}
var MyMar=setInterval(Marquee,speed)
demo.onmouseover=function() {clearInterval(MyMar)}
demo.onmouseout=function() {MyMar=setInterval(Marquee,speed)}
</script> 展开
<div id=demo1>
<ul>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
<li>图片连续循环滚动代码(向上)</li>
</ul>
</div>
<div id=demo2></div>
</div>
<script language="javascript">
var speed=10
demo2.innerHTML=demo1.innerHTML
function Marquee(){
if(demo2.offsetTop-demo.scrollTop<=0)
demo.scrollTop-=demo1.offsetHeight
else{
demo.scrollTop++
}
}
var MyMar=setInterval(Marquee,speed)
demo.onmouseover=function() {clearInterval(MyMar)}
demo.onmouseout=function() {MyMar=setInterval(Marquee,speed)}
</script> 展开
2个回答
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询